Buddhists and philanthropists in Nghe An bring love to flooded areas in Western Nghe An

On July 29-31, a volunteer group of Buddhists and philanthropists from Nghe An province traveled hundreds of kilometers to reach people in remote areas of the western region of Nghe An; promptly sharing difficulties and encouraging people to quickly overcome the consequences of floods.

Understanding the difficulties of people in flood-hit areas, Venerable Thich Tue Minh, Head of the Buddhist Guidance Board, Nghe An Provincial Buddhist Sangha, directed Buddhist Cao Huy (Chi Minh Dao) to launch the program "Towards flood-hit areas - Joining hands to overcome difficulties".

The campaign, imbued with the spirit of compassion, quickly spread and received the support of many Buddhists and many kind-hearted people in the province.

The delegation directly visited and presented gifts to people in many villages severely affected by natural disasters. The gifts were not only rice, necessities, and clothes, but also words of greeting and a loving presence while people were struggling to recover from the storm and flood.

During the 2-day journey, the delegation presented a total of 189 gifts to people in many difficult areas, specifically: 30 gifts in Huoi Tho, Dinh Son, Na Luong, Khe Ty villages (Huu Kiem 2 commune); 37 gifts in Binh Son 1 village (Muong Xen commune); 51 gifts in Huoi Cang 1, Huoi Cang 2, Phia Kham 2, Buoc, Na Kho villages (Bac Ly commune); 55 gifts in Xop Tu village (My Ly commune); 16 gifts in Lang Nhung village (Tam Quang commune); in addition, the delegation also presented many necessities and clothes to support people in Cua Rao 2 village, Tuong Duong commune.

The total value of gifts and items in this charity event is over 100 million VND .

Not only providing material assistance, the volunteer journey is also a spiritual connection, adding hope to the people in the flooded areas. The meaningful steps of Buddhists and philanthropists have contributed to spreading the spirit of mutual love in the community./.
